Crawl Errors

Crawl errors occur when search engines encounter issues while trying to access your website. These problems can lead to significant drops in visibility and traffic. There are various types of crawl errors, including 404 pages that don’t exist or server response issues. When a bot encounters such an error, it may prevent the indexing of certain pages altogether. You can use tools like Google Search Console to identify these errors easily.

Regular monitoring is essential for maintaining site health. Fixing crawl errors often involves redirecting broken links or updating the sitemap so that bots have a clear path through your site.

Duplicate Content

Duplicate content is a thorn in the side of effective SEO. It confuses search engines, making it tough for them to determine which version of a page should rank higher. This can dilute your site’s authority and ultimately hurt your visibility. Common culprits include similar product descriptions on e-commerce sites or articles that appear on multiple domains. While this might seem harmless at first, it signals to search engines that you’re not providing unique value. To combat this issue, consider implementing canonical tags. They help indicate the preferred version of a page when duplicates exist.

Page Speed Issues

Page speed is crucial for user experience and SEO. A slow-loading website can turn visitors away in seconds. When users encounter delays, they often abandon the page before it even fully loads. Search engines like Google also factor in loading times when ranking sites. If your pages lag behind competitors, you risk losing valuable visibility in search results. There are several culprits behind the sluggish performance. Large image files, excessive scripts, and unoptimized code can lead to slow load times. It’s essential to regularly audit your site for these issues.

Poor Mobile Usability

Mobile usability is crucial in today’s digital landscape. With more smartphone users accessing websites, having a well-optimized mobile experience can’t be overlooked. If your site isn’t responsive, it may frustrate visitors. Pages that don’t resize properly or load incorrectly lead to high bounce rates. Navigation plays a key role as well. If users struggle to find what they need due to small buttons or cluttered layouts, they will likely leave without engaging further. Loading times are another factor; slow pages can deter even the most patient user from sticking around.
